Accessibility for All:
Automatic doors promote inclusivity by providing barrier-free access for individuals with disabilities or limited mobility. The motion sensors or push-button systems allow individuals using wheelchairs, walkers, or other mobility aids to enter and exit buildings independently. By eliminating physical barriers, automatic doors ensure equal access for all individuals, fostering a more inclusive environment.

Safety and Security:
Automatic doors prioritize safety by incorporating sensors that detect obstacles in the doorway. These sensors ensure that the doors do not close on individuals or objects, preventing accidents or injuries. Automatic doors can also be integrated with access control systems, allowing authorized personnel to enter while restricting unauthorized entry. This enhances security and helps maintain a safe environment.
